One of the challenges encountered in the ongoing development and expansion of special operations aviation elements across many regions involves differences in “risk perception” that exist between conventional pilots and special operations units in some tactical scenarios.

That was one of the observations reported by international representatives at this week’s Global Special Operations Forces Symposium, held in Tampa, Florida by the Global SOF Foundation.
